■ DESCRIPTION
The MB86613 a high-performance, host-bus (PCI) and serial-bus (1394) controller chip for controlling transfer between the PCI and 1394 buses. This chip conforms to the PCI Standard Version 2.1 for PCI control, the IEEE 1394-1995 Standard for 1394 control, and the Open HCI Standard Version 1.0 for PCI-1394 control.
■ FEATURES
1. 1394 serial bus controller Unit
• Compliant with IEEE 1394-1995 Standard
• PHYsical and LINK layer modules integrated on a single chip
• Three internal ports
• Transfer rates of S100, S200, and S400 supported
• On-chip PLL for generating 400-MHz (PHY) and 50-MHz (LINK) CLK signals
• Built-in cycle master function
• Bus management CSR (control and status register)
• Six-conductor cable supported
• Internal transceiver and comparator
• Internal comparator for cable power detection
2. Context program controller unit
• Compliant with Open HCI Standard (Draft 1.00)
• Thirteen context program controllers integrated:
• Internal 6-KB FIFO buffers
Asynchronous Transmit DMA …2ch
•Asynchronous response …1ch
•Asynchronous request …1ch
Isochronous Transmit DMA …4ch
Receive DMA …7ch
•Asynchronous response …1ch
•Asynchronous request …1ch
•Isochronous …4ch
•SelfID …1ch
Asynchronous Transmit FIFO …1.5 Kbyte
isochronous Transmit FIFO …1.5 Kbyte
Asynchronous/Isochronous Receive FIFO …3.0 Kbyte
3. PCI bus controller unit
• Compliant with PCI Standard (Revision 2.2)
• On-chip 32-bit DMA controller
• Built-in power management function (Compliant with PCI bus power management standard version 1.0)
• Built-in alignment function
• Built-in byte swap function
• Operating frequency of up to 33 MHz
• Internal parallel ROM interface
• Internal serial ROM interface
• Internal universal (5/3.3 V shared) PCI buffer
4. Physical specifications
• Package: LQFP144 (FPT-144P-M08), FBGA176 (BGA-176P-M02)
• Power-supply voltage: Dual system for 5 V (± 5) and 3.3 V (± 5)
5. Reference standards
• IEEE Standard for a High Performance 1394-1995
• 1394 Open Host Controller Interface Specification (Release 1.00)
• PCI Specification (Revision 2.2)
• PCI Bus Power Management Interface Specification (Version 1.0)
